El Camino Oscuro hacia el Anonimato: Dominando TOR y TORGhost

La red es un laberinto de datos, y las identidades son tan efímeras como un eco en la oscuridad digital. Moverse sin dejar rastro, sin que las miradas indiscretas se claven en tu camino, es el Santo Grial del operador anónimo. Hoy no vamos a configurar un simple proxy; vamos a forjar un túnel, un pasaje secreto a través de la jungla de información global. Hablamos de dominación del anonimato con TOR Browser y la herramienta de élite, TORGhost.

Este tutorial no es para novatos asustadizos. Es una inmersión profunda en cómo asegurar tu presencia en línea, cómo desdibujar las líneas y hacer que tu tráfico sea una sombra esquiva. Prepárate para una autopsia digital del anonimato.

Tabla de Contenidos

El Misterio del Anonimato en la Red

En esta era de vigilancia digital constante, donde cada clic se registra y cada movimiento en línea se rastrea, la idea de **anonimato** se ha convertido en una necesidad para muchos. Ya sea para proteger la privacidad, eludir la censura o realizar investigaciones sensibles, comprender las herramientas que nos permiten navegar sin ser detectados es fundamental. TOR (The Onion Router) es la piedra angular de esta libertad digital, una red de voluntarios que permite una comunicación anónima.

Sin embargo, la simple instalación de TOR Browser es solo el primer paso. Para aquellos que operan en el filo de la espada digital, especialmente en entornos Linux como Kali Linux, un control más granular sobre el tráfico de red es imprescindible. Aquí es donde entra en juego TORGhost, un script diseñado para forzar que todo el tráfico de tu sistema pase a través de la red TOR, añadiendo una capa crucial de seguridad.

Este documento es una destilación de conocimiento operativo, un manual para aquellos que buscan no solo acceder a TOR, sino también incrustarlo en la arquitectura de su sistema de forma robusta. Analizaremos la instalación y configuración tanto del conocido TOR Browser como de la potentísima herramienta TORGhost en entornos Linux.

TOR Browser: Tu Primera Puerta al Manto

TOR Browser no es solo un navegador; es tu vehículo de entrada principal a la red TOR. Basado en Firefox, ha sido modificado para aislar la navegación de tu actividad en línea, de modo que no puedas ser rastreado. Cada sitio web que visitas a través de TOR Browser se enruta a través de una serie de relés voluntarios, cifrando tu tráfico en cada salto.

La belleza de TOR Browser reside en su simplicidad de uso. Para la mayoría de los usuarios, la instalación es tan sencilla como descargar un archivo y ejecutarlo. Sin embargo, incluso en esta aparente simplicidad, existen configuraciones y consideraciones que pueden mejorar significativamente tu nivel de anonimato. Las opciones de seguridad, por ejemplo, permiten ajustar el nivel de protección, desde el más básico hasta el más restrictivo, que puede afectar la funcionalidad de algunos sitios web pero maximiza tu privacidad.

"El anonimato no es un privilegio, es un derecho fundamental en un mundo cada vez más vigilado."

Mientras que en Windows la instalación es un proceso directo, en Linux, la gestión de paquetes y permisos puede requerir un enfoque ligeramente diferente, aunque el principio sigue siendo el mismo: descargar, instalar y ejecutar. La descarga oficial desde torproject.org es la única ruta segura para obtener el navegador, evitando así distribuciones maliciosas que podrían comprometer tu seguridad antes incluso de empezar a navegar.

Guía de Implementación: TOR Browser en Windows

La instalación de TOR Browser en Windows es un proceso guiado que no requiere de habilidades técnicas avanzadas. Sin embargo, cada paso bien ejecutado contribuye a tu postura de seguridad.

  1. Descarga el Instalador: Dirígete al sitio oficial de descargas de TOR Project: torproject.org/projects/torbrowser.html.en. Busca la sección de descargas para Windows y obtén el archivo ejecutable. Es imperativo descargarla de la fuente oficial para evitar malware.
  2. Ejecuta el Instalador: Una vez descargado, haz doble clic en el archivo `.exe`. Se te pedirá que selecciones el idioma y la ubicación de instalación.
  3. Acepta la Instalación: Sigue las indicaciones del asistente de instalación. Generalmente, puedes aceptar la configuración predeterminada, pero presta atención a las opciones por si deseas personalizar la instalación.
  4. Inicia TOR Browser: Al finalizar la instalación, se creará un acceso directo en tu escritorio. Haz doble clic para lanzar TOR Browser. La primera vez que lo inicies, te ofrecerá la opción de conectarte directamente o configurar ajustes de red (como un proxy o un puente). Para la mayoría de los usuarios, la conexión directa es suficiente.
  5. Verifica la Conexión: Una vez conectado, TOR Browser te presentará una página de bienvenida. Para confirmar que tu tráfico está siendo enrutado a través de TOR, puedes visitar sitios como check.torproject.org. Si todo está configurado correctamente, verás un mensaje indicando que tu navegador está configurado para usar TOR.

Recuerda que TOR Browser está diseñado para ser una herramienta de navegación anónima. No es recomendable instalar extensiones o complementos adicionales, ya que estos podrían comprometer tu anonimato. Para un análisis más profundo o para aquellos que buscan la máxima seguridad, la configuración de los niveles de seguridad dentro de TOR Browser es el siguiente paso lógico.

TORGhost: El Fantasma en la Máquina de Linux

Mientras que TOR Browser protege tu tráfico de navegación web, TORGhost va un paso más allá. Este script de código abierto, disponible principalmente para distribuciones basadas en Debian/Ubuntu y Arch Linux, está diseñado para forzar que *todo* el tráfico saliente de tu sistema pase a través de la red TOR. Esto incluye no solo la navegación web, sino también las conexiones de aplicaciones de línea de comandos, actualizaciones de sistema, y cualquier otro servicio que intente comunicarse con internet.

La implementación de TORGhost es especialmente relevante en entornos de pentesting y análisis de seguridad, donde un compromiso de la identidad del atacante es tan crítico como la propia explotación. Utilizar Kali Linux como plataforma de operaciones ofrece un ecosistema potente para este tipo de tareas, y TORGhost se integra perfectamente en este flujo de trabajo.

La lógica detrás de TORGhost es simple pero efectiva: manipula las reglas de `iptables` (el firewall de Linux) para redirigir todo el tráfico (TCP, UDP) al puerto de escucha de SOCKS de Tor (generalmente 9050). Esto crea un túnelForAll, un sistema de 'túnel todo o nada' que te asegura que nada escapa a la red TOR si TORGhost está activo.

"En el mundo de la seguridad, no se trata de si serás atacado, sino de cuándo. Estar preparado es la única defensa real."

La instalación y uso de TORGhost requiere permisos de superusuario (`sudo`), ya que las modificaciones del firewall son operaciones sensibles del sistema. La página oficial de TORGhost en GitHub es la fuente autorizada para su descarga e instrucciones de instalación, asegurando que obtienes la versión más reciente y segura.

Taller Práctico: Configurando TORGhost en Kali Linux

Vamos a desglosar el proceso de instalación y configuración de TORGhost en un entorno de Kali Linux. Este es un procedimiento directo si sigues los pasos, pero la precisión es clave.

  1. Actualiza tu Sistema: Antes de instalar cualquier nuevo software, es una práctica recomendada asegurar que tu sistema está al día. Abre una terminal y ejecuta:
    sudo apt update && sudo apt upgrade -y
  2. Clona el Repositorio de TORGhost: Necesitarás `git` instalado. Si no lo tienes, instálalo primero con `sudo apt install git -y`. Luego, clona el repositorio desde GitHub:
    git clone https://github.com/susmithHCK/torghost.git
  3. Navega al Directorio: Entra en la carpeta que acabas de clonar:
    cd torghost
  4. Ejecuta el Script de Instalación: El repositorio incluye un script `install.sh` que automatiza la configuración. Ejecútalo con permisos de superusuario:
    sudo ./install.sh
    El script configurará `iptables` y descargará los paquetes necesarios de Tor si aún no están presentes.
  5. Activa TORGhost: Una vez instalado, puedes habilitar el túnel para todo el tráfico. Usa el siguiente comando:
    sudo torghost enable
    Este comando activará las reglas de `iptables` para redirigir el tráfico.
  6. Verifica tu IP Pública: Para confirmar que tu tráfico está pasando por TOR, puedes verificar tu dirección IP pública. Abre otra instancia de la terminal o usa un navegador que no esté configurado para usar TOR (si TORGhost está configurado globalmente).
    curl ifconfig.me
    Deberías ver una dirección IP que no es la tuya, sino la de un nodo de salida de TOR.
  7. Desactiva TORGhost: Cuando necesites volver a tu conexión normal, desactiva TORGhost con el siguiente comando:
    sudo torghost disable
    Esto revertirá los cambios en `iptables`.

Es crucial entender que TORGhost fuerza todo el tráfico a través de TOR. Si TOR se cae o no está disponible, tu conexión a internet se detendrá. Esto garantiza que no haya fugas de IP accidentales, pero también significa que dependes completamente de la estabilidad de la red TOR. Para profesionales que valoran la discreción por encima de la velocidad o la disponibilidad constante, esta es una contrapartida aceptable.

Veredicto del Ingeniero: Escalando el Anonimato

TOR Browser es indispensable para la navegación anónima y segura. Su facilidad de uso lo convierte en la puerta de entrada para la mayoría de los usuarios. Sin embargo, como herramienta individual, solo protege el tráfico del navegador. Para operaciones más complejas, donde la seguridad del sistema operativo es primordial, TOR Browser por sí solo es insuficiente.

TORGhost, por otro lado, representa una mejora significativa al forzar todo el tráfico del sistema a través de la red TOR. Su implementación en entornos como Kali Linux es un movimiento inteligente para cualquier profesional de la seguridad que valore el anonimato absoluto. La combinación de TOR Browser para la navegación discreta y TORGhost para la protección integral del sistema convierte a un operador en una sombra digital difícil de rastrear.

Pros de TORGhost:

  • Protección total del tráfico de red del sistema.
  • Previene fugas de IP accidentales.
  • Ideal para operaciones de pentesting y análisis de seguridad.
  • Integración relativamente sencilla con distribuciones Linux populares.

Contras de TORGhost:

  • Puede degradar significativamente la velocidad de conexión.
  • Cualquier problema con la red TOR detiene toda la conectividad a internet.
  • Requiere permisos de `sudo`, lo que implica un riesgo si el sistema base está comprometido.

Desde una perspectiva de ingeniería adversaria, entender estas herramientas es vital. Un defensor debe saber cómo se implementan estas capas de anonimato para poder identificar posibles debilidades o métodos de evasión, mientras que un atacante las utiliza para mantenerse oculto. La compra de certificaciones de seguridad ofensiva como la OSCP puede proporcionar la experiencia práctica para evaluar estas herramientas en escenarios reales.

Preguntas Frecuentes

  • ¿Es TOR completamente anónimo?
    TOR proporciona un alto nivel de anonimato, pero no es 100% infalible. Las fugas de IP pueden ocurrir debido a errores de configuración, vulnerabilidades del navegador (como JavaScript malicioso) o ataques coordinados (como el análisis de tráfico). Siempre es recomendable complementar TOR con otras prácticas de seguridad.
  • ¿Puedo usar TORGhost en Windows?
    TORGhost es principalmente un script para Linux que modifica las reglas de `iptables`. Si bien existen métodos para forzar todo el tráfico de Windows a través de TOR (como usar Proxifier o configurar la red TOR como el gateway predeterminado), TORGhost como tal no está diseñado para Windows. Para Windows, TOR Browser es la herramienta principal, y para un enrutamiento de tráfico más amplio, se necesitarían soluciones de terceros más complejas.
  • ¿Qué tan seguro es descargar TOR Browser de otras fuentes que no sean el sitio oficial?
    Es extremadamente inseguro. Los atacantes a menudo distribuyen versiones modificadas de TOR Browser o TORGhost que contienen malware o backdoors, lo que compromete completamente tu anonimato y seguridad. Siempre descarga software de fuentes oficiales y verificadas como torproject.org y GitHub.
  • ¿Afecta TORGhost a la velocidad de mi conexión?
    Sí, considerablemente. Forzar todo el tráfico a través de la red TOR añade latencia y reduce el ancho de banda disponible. La velocidad dependerá de la calidad de los nodos de salida de TOR y de la congestión de la red.

El Contrato: Tu Misión de Anonimato

Hemos trazado los caminos, hemos abierto las puertas al manto de TOR y desatado el espectro de TORGhost. Ahora, la teoría debe convertirse en práctica. Tu misión, si decides aceptarla, es consolidar este conocimiento.

El desafío final es simple pero crítico: Configura un entorno virtualizado con Kali Linux. Instala TORBrowser. Luego, instala y activa TORGhost. Utiliza una herramienta de monitoreo de red (como Wireshark) para observar qué tráfico se está redirigiendo cuando TORGhost está activo frente a cuando no lo está. Documenta tus hallazgos, especialmente identificando cualquier tráfico que *intente* escapar del túnel de TORGhost (aunque idealmente no deberías encontrar ninguno si está configurado correctamente) y hazlo más difícil de ver.

¿Estás listo para ser el fantasma en la máquina?

No comments:

Post a Comment